DON'T BE Up the Creek WITHOUT A PADDLE, AND OTHER GOOD INFORMATION
Sugar Creek has a "carry-in, carry-out" policy for trash. Trash bags available at the office. DO NOT LITTER. Fines of $500 or more for littering Sugar Creek.
No styrofoam coolers or glass containers allowed on Sugar Creek.
ALCOHOL
Limited amount of alcohol allowed on trips. Public intoxication and under-age drinking will not be permitted and laws will be enforced. Sections of Sugar Creek are subject to state park regulations. Alcohol limit: 3 per person.
- Alcohol policy agreement must be signed by all participants.
- Additional $50 deposit and credit card number required when taking alcohol on the trips.

Sugar Valley takes cash, checks or credit cards for payment of rental fees but deposits must be paid in cash or check (since they are usually returned at the end of trip)
CANCELLATIONS
Cancellations must be called in 5 days before date for deposit return. We run Rain or Shine. Cancelled trips due to high water will be refunded.
DEPOSIT REQUIRED
Additional deposit ($20 minimum or $5 per canoe/kayak) required. Lost deposit and additional fees charged for missing your pick-up time. Lost deposit and additional fees charged for lost, destroyed, abandoned or lodged equip.
ARRIVAL
Arrive 30 minutes prior to departure time.
